No, there is no direct bus from Turin to CERN. However, there are services departing from Turin station and arriving at CERN station via Chambéry - Bus Station station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 20m.
Turin to CERN bus services, operated by BlaBlaCar Bus, depart from Turin - Vittorio Emanuele Bus Station.
Turin to CERN bus services, operated by BlaBlaCar Bus, arrive at Geneva - Airport Bus Station.
The distance between Turin and CERN is 181.5 km. The road distance is 305 km.
